#776658 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#776658 is composed of 46.7% red, 40%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 14.3% magenta, 26.1% yellow and 53.3% black. It has a hue angle of 27.1 degrees, a saturation of 15% and a lightness of 40.6%. #776658 color hex could be obtained by blending #eeccb0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

● #776658 color description : Mostly desaturated dark orange.
#776658 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#776658 has RGB values of R:119, G:102,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.14, Y:0.26,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 7824984.

Shades and Tints of #776658
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060505 is the darkest color, while #fbfbf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#776658
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6f6760 is the less saturated color, while #cf5e00 is the most saturated one.
